Harvesting vegetation on riparian buffers barely reduces water-quality benefits

Allowing farmers to harvest vegetation from their riparian buffers will not significantly impede the ability of those streamside tracts to protect water quality by capturing nutrients and sediment — and it will boost farmers’ willingness to establish buffers.

Coral’s resilience to warming may depend on iron

How well corals respond to climate change could depend in part on the already scarce amount of iron available in their environment, according to a new study led by Penn State researchers.

New tool for identifying endangered corals could aid conservation efforts

Coral conservation efforts could get a boost from a newly developed genotyping “chip” — the first of its kind for corals. The chip allows researchers to genetically identify corals and the symbiotic algae that live within the coral’s cells, a vital step for establishing and maintaining genetic diversity in reef restoration efforts.

Invasive shrubs in Northeast forests grow leaves earlier and keep them longer

The rapid pace that invasive shrubs infiltrate forests in the northeastern United States makes scientists suspect they have a consistent advantage over native shrubs, and the first region-wide study of leaf timing, conducted by Penn State researchers, supports those suspicions.

Cover crop roots are key to understanding ecosystem services

To judge the overall effectiveness of cover crops and choose those offering the most ecosystem services, agricultural scientists must consider the plants’ roots as well as above-ground biomass, according to Penn State researchers who tested the characteristics of cover crop roots in three monocultures and one mixture.

Flavonoids' presence in sorghum roots may lead to frost-resistant crop

​Flavonoid compounds — produced by the roots of some sorghum plants — positively affect soil microorganisms, according to Penn State researchers, who suggest the discovery is an early step in developing a frost-resistant line of the valuable crop for North American farmers.​

Gall fly outmaneuvers host plant in game of 'Spy vs. Spy'

Over time, goldenrod plants and the gall flies that feed on them have been one-upping each other in an ongoing competition for survival. Now, a team of researchers has discovered that by detecting the plants’ chemical defenses, the insects may have taken the lead.
